DynamicDataRoute ク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
ASP.NET Dynamic Data で使用されるルートを表します。
public ref class DynamicDataRoute : System::Web::Routing::Route
public class DynamicDataRoute : System.Web.Routing.Route
type DynamicDataRoute = class
inherit Route
Public Class DynamicDataRoute
Inherits Route
- 継承
注釈
ルートを使用して動的データの動作を構成します。
型の静的プロパティには、 Routes RouteTable ルートのコレクションが保持されます。 動的データの場合、通常、1つまたは複数のルートが global.asax ファイルのイベントに登録されます (プロパティに追加され Routes Application_Start
ます)。 たとえば、ルートは、行の一覧と同じページにデータ行の詳細を表示するかどうかを決定します。 また、一部のテーブルの行の一覧と同じページに詳細を表示するかどうかを決定することもできます。
、、、およびの各プロパティを設定 Action し、 ViewName コンストラクターの Table Model URL のパターンを指定し Route ます。
動的データは、指定した URL パターンを使用して要求の URL パターンを一致させ、url を作成します。 詳細については、「DynamicDataRoute」を参照してください。
コンストラクター
DynamicDataRoute(String) |
指定した URL パターンを使用して、DynamicDataRoute クラスの新しいインスタンスを初期化します。 |
プロパティ
Action |
ルートのアクションの名前を取得または設定します。 |
Constraints |
URL パラメーターの有効な値を指定する式のディクショナリを取得または設定します。 (継承元 Route) |
DataTokens |
ルート ハンドラーに渡されるが、ルートが URL パターンに一致するかどうかの判定には使用されないカスタム値を取得または設定します。 (継承元 Route) |
Defaults |
URL にすべてのパラメーターが含まれていない場合に使用する値を取得または設定します。 (継承元 Route) |
Model |
ルートが適用されるデータ モデルを取得または設定します。 |
RouteExistingFiles |
既存のファイルと一致する URL を ASP.NET ルーティングが処理するかどうかを示す値を取得または設定します。 (継承元 RouteBase) |
RouteHandler |
ルートの要求を処理するオブジェクトを取得または設定します。 |
Table |
ルートのテーブルの名前を取得または設定します。 |
Url |
ルートの URL パターンを取得または設定します。 (継承元 Route) |
ViewName |
ルートに関連付けられた .aspx ページの名前を取得または設定します。 |
メソッド
Equals(Object) |
指定されたオブジェクトが現在のオブジェクトと等しいかどうかを判断します。 (継承元 Object) |
GetActionFromRouteData(RouteData) |
Dynamic Data の現在の Web 要求の RouteData オブジェクトからアクションを返します。 |
GetHashCode() |
既定のハッシュ関数として機能します。 (継承元 Object) |
GetRouteData(HttpContextBase) |
特定の Web 要求のルーティング情報を返します。 |
GetTableFromRouteData(RouteData) |
Dynamic Data の Web ページ要求に関連付けられているテーブルを識別します。 |
GetType() |
現在のインスタンスの Type を取得します。 (継承元 Object) |
GetVirtualPath(RequestContext, RouteValueDictionary) |
ルートの仮想パスを返します。 |
MemberwiseClone() |
現在の Object の簡易コピーを作成します。 (継承元 Object) |
ProcessConstraint(HttpContextBase, Object, String, RouteValueDictionary, RouteDirection) |
パラメーター値がそのパラメーターの制約と一致するかどうかを判別します。 (継承元 Route) |
ToString() |
現在のオブジェクトを表す文字列を返します。 (継承元 Object) |